Refrigerant R-134a enters the compressor of a refrigerationmachine at 140 kPa pressure and -10 ° C temperature and exits at 1MPa pressure. The volumetric flow of the refrigerant entering thecompressor is 0.23 m3 / minute. The refrigerant enters thethrottling valve at 0.95 MPa pressure and 30 ° C, exiting theevaporator as saturated steam at -18 ° C. The adiabatic efficiencyof the compressor is 78%. Show the cycle in the T-s diagram. Inaddition,

a) the power required to start the compressor,
b) Heat drawn from the cooled medium per unit time,COPSM =?

c) Calculate between the evaporator and the compressor, how muchthe pressure of the refrigerant drops and how much the heat gainis.
